Dell OpenManage Network Integration <3.9 Improper Auth Remote Info Exposure
CVE-2026-22764 Published on January 29, 2026

Dell OpenManage Network Integration, versions prior to 3.9, contains an Improper Authentication vulnerability. A low privileged attacker with remote access could potentially exploit this vulnerability, leading to Information exposure.

What is an authentification Vulnerability?

When an actor claims to have a given identity, the software does not prove or insufficiently proves that the claim is correct.

CVE-2026-22764 has been classified to as an authentification vulnerability or weakness.
